Word of the Week: Monograph

February 20, 2008
By Matt Bailey

monograph: mon-uh-graf

A monograph is a scholarly book on a single subject, class of subjects, or person. In the library field, this term is also used for any non-serial publication. Monographs are often lengthy works on a particular subject or person, detailed in treatment, which usually contain a bibliography.
